Recently, I went to Legacy Chiropractic at Laurel Manor for excruciating back pain. One gentleman came in and said that he had seen this before and could take care of me. I, then had x-rays to the tune of $120.00 payable right away. Note x rays, most generally, are not covered by insurance UNLESS they are ordered by an MD. They applied an ultrasound which gave some relief. Expecting a second treatment the next day, a young lady came in and gave us an 'infomercial' on a table that would stretch me out and would also improve posture.....to the tune of $1500.00. They also informed me that they could set up a 'payment plan' which was hardly the issue. We had three 'closers' come in trying to cram in as many visits as they could since we go up north for the summer. Needless to say, here is my good advice: See an MD so your insurance will cover it and have your MD refer physical therapy...which I will do.
